mozharness/repackage/base.py
author Rob Lemley <rob@thunderbird.net>
Thu, 25 Apr 2019 06:57:51 -0400
changeset 34358 245790807d1f3b2e7680ede2b8b2b592587bd38b
parent 33211 78daaa93369e8c57c78390b6a0e3d16c121bba7a
child 37662 c8aea2febde1ce9fb9ddf30a5fc2fd540d9fa02e
permissions -rw-r--r--
Bug 1516741 - Finalize MSI packaging for Thunderbird. r=Paenglab Generate new GUID values for Thunderbird. These are new for the MSI installer rather than reused from the EXE. Set correct Product name and remove Manufacturer field. Fix taskcluster configuration so that correct wsx file gets used.

import os

# Paths are relative to mozilla-central
config = {
    "package-name": "thunderbird",
    "installer-tag": "comm/mail/installer/windows/app.tag",
    "sfx-stub": "comm/other-licenses/7zstub/thunderbird/7zSD.sfx",
    "stub-installer-tag": "",
    "wsx-stub": "comm/mail/installer/windows/msi/installer.wxs",
    "fetch-dir": os.environ.get('MOZ_FETCHES_DIR'),
}